Highlighting 10 Quirky Hobbies

In the realm of hobbies, there exists a plethora of peculiar activities that push the boundaries of conventional interests. Below is a curated list of ten quirky hobbies that may intrigue those seeking to add an element of uniqueness to their leisure time.

1. **Extreme Ironing**: This unconventional pastime combines the thrill of extreme sports with the mundane task of ironing. Originating in England, extreme ironing enthusiasts take their boards and wrinkled shirts to locations such as mountain summits or underwater settings. It is a creative way to challenge oneself and embrace adventure while completing a household chore.

2. **Competitive Duck Herding**: In this unique hobby, participants train dogs to herd ducks through obstacle courses. Usually organized as a sport in various countries, competitive duck herding showcases a blend of skill, precision, and a delightful connection with animals, making it an entertaining spectacle for both participants and audiences.

3. **Professional Pillow Fighting**: Rediscovering the joy of playful combat, professional pillow fighting has gained traction as an organized competitive sport. Events often pit teams against each other, complete with rules and scoring systems, making it a fun outlet for athletes with a sense of humor and creativity.

4. **Soap Carving**: This intriguing hobby involves transforming bars of soap into intricate sculptures using simple tools. Originating as a childhood pastime, it has blossomed into an art form that promotes mindfulness and fine motor skills while allowing for artistic expression.

5. **Fingerboarding**: A scaled-down version of skateboarding, fingerboarding involves using miniature skateboards that are maneuvered with the fingers. Gaining popularity in the 1990s, it allows enthusiasts to showcase tricks and creativity in a compact and accessible manner.

6. **Mooing Competitions**: These playful contests invite participants to mimic the sound of cows. Originating in rural communities, mooing competitions emphasize humor and vocal skill, bringing people together in a lighthearted atmosphere.

7. **Hula-hooping**: While many may associate hula-hooping with childhood, it has evolved into a fitness trend and performance art. Practitioners engage in intricate movements, tricks, and dance, creating a captivating visual spectacle.

8. **Quidditch**: Inspired by the Harry Potter series, this sport combines elements of rugby and dodgeball. Played on a field with broomsticks, the game has spawned numerous leagues worldwide, demonstrating the cultural impact of literature on recreational activities.

9. **Nurdle collecting**: Environmental enthusiasts engage in collecting plastic pellets known as nurdles washed ashore. This eco-conscious hobby raises awareness about plastic pollution while promoting community involvement in cleanup efforts.

10. **Trainspotting**: A fascinating hobby for rail enthusiasts, trainspotting involves observing and documenting the various types of trains in operation. Trainspotters often travel extensively to catch sight of rare models, fostering a unique sense of community and knowledge about rail transport.
